Half-time is the 15-minute break between the two 45-minute halves. Teams change ends, managers give team talks, fans get pies. 'At half-time' is a common reference point.

From the literal midpoint of the game. Standard in most team sports. Half-time became important for commercials and entertainment in modern football.
